Sinners Rules the Box Office


Ryan Coogler's new movie Sinners continues to defy box office predictions...

Warner Bros.’ “Sinners” has become a can’t-miss film, and the box office numbers show it. After earning a strong $48 million opening weekend, Ryan Coogler’s original horror film is holding its second weekend drop to a breathtaking 8% as industry estimates are projecting a $44 million total.
Exhibitor sources tell TheWrap that despite being in theaters for a week, sold out screenings for premium formats are being reported in Los Angeles, New York, Atlanta and San Francisco. For Warner Bros., this is their best second weekend hold since their 2018 hit romcom “Crazy Rich Asians,” which opened to $26.5 million and then dropped just 6.4% with a $24.8 million second weekend.
The film is now on pace to become the first original film since Disney/Pixar’s “Coco” eight years ago to gross $200 million domestic with an industry estimated $121 million total through Sunday. Since its release, “Sinners” has enjoyed a level of critical and audience acclaim rarely seen for any film, let alone for an original horror offering, and has been drawing in moviegoers who weren’t all aware of the film’s existence prior to its release.
